Does chlorine have 2 energy levels?

Does chlorine have 2 energy levels?

Chlorine has 17 electrons. The n=2 level can hold up to eight electrons so the next 8 electrons will go in the n=2 level. The remaining 7 electrons can go in the n=3 level since it holds a maximum of 8 electrons. The electron arrangement of chlorine is (2, 8, 7).

What does the 2 in chlorine indicate?

The 2 in front of 2Cl just means that there are 2 single chlorine ions. These ions are NOT bonded to each other. The 2 written in Cl2 means that there are two chlorine atoms covalently bonded to form a chlorine molecule.

How many pairs of electrons does chlorine have?

Each chlorine atom now has an octet. The electron pair being shared by the atoms is called a bonding pair ; the other three pairs of electrons on each chlorine atom are called lone pairs.

What element contains a full second energy level?

After the first energy level contains 2 electrons (helium), the next electrons go into the second energy level. After the second energy level has 8 electrons (neon), the next electrons go into the third energy level.

Why chlorine is soluble in water?

Chlorine gas is soluble because it disproportionates in water. This is a disproportionation reaction whereby Chlorine is both oxidised ( 0 in Cl2 to 1- in HCl) and reduced ( 0 in Cl2 to 1+ in HClO). This is rather a reaction than ordinary hydration. Thus, this happens relatively spontaneous.

How much chlorine is in a litre of water?

Chlorine is present in most disinfected drinking-water at concentrations of 0.2–1 mg/litre (3). Food Cake flour bleached with chlorine contains chloride at levels in the range 1.3–1.9 g/kg.

What is chlorination and how does it work?

Chlorination is the process of adding chlorine to drinking water to kill parasites, bacteria, and viruses. Different processes can be used to achieve safe levels of chlorine in drinking water. Using or drinking water with small amounts of chlorine does not cause harmful health effects and provides protection against waterborne disease outbreaks.
